CAD and BIM Integration



Gstarsoft is committed to enhancing connectivity between existing workflows and model-driven delivery. This commitment is evident in the latest version of GstarCAD 2027, designed for stability and efficiency with a remarkable 7.6 times faster drawing regeneration, double the file opening speed, and eightfold memory optimization. These enhancements make GstarCAD 2027 perfect for demanding engineering environments.

In the construction sector, the updated GstarBIM 2027 has further expanded its capabilities. This platform now features integrated workflows for Mechanical, Electrical, and Plumbing (MEP) systems, as well as advanced tools for 2D to 3D conversion, point cloud modeling, and AI-assisted visualization. This strategic move not only simplifies architectural coordination but also strengthens compliance with open standards like IFC (Industry Foundation Classes).

Cloud Solutions for Modern Design Workflows



Gstarsoft’s cloud solutions facilitate a hybrid transition for teams navigating multi-dimensional design projects. The GstarCAD Cloud introduces a native 2D CAD platform that promotes real-time collaboration and secure drawing management via a web browser. Built on the same core technologies as its desktop counterparts, this platform ensures seamless continuity between local and cloud environments.

In addition, Gstar3D Cloud offers AI-driven collaboration for product design and engineering, enabling 3D modeling and unified data management within a single environment. GstarCAD 365 takes this a step further by serving as a cloud-based CAD collaboration hub, optimizing communication and document management throughout the project lifecycle.

AI Integration: Transforming Design Processes



The integration of AI across Gstarsoft's product lineup revolutionizes how design data is processed and utilized. The AI Assistant allows natural language interactions within CAD workflows, drastically improving design generation, task automation, and access to engineering knowledge—shifting CAD from a command-based tool to a more intuitive design environment.

Moreover, tools like AI ScanToCAD transform image-based drawings into editable CAD content, enabling organizations to digitize legacy documents efficiently. GstarRender enhances visual communication and design presentation, catering especially to architecture and interior design projects with its capabilities for high-quality rendering and animation.
